EGG AND BACON TOPPED MUFFINS



Egg and Bacon Topped Muffins image

Bake these split English muffins topped with cheese, eggs and bacon pieces into hot sandwiches for a 15 minute dinner idea!

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Side Dish

Time 15m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 tablespoons purchased honey mustard*
2 English muffins, split, toasted
4 (3/4-oz.) slices American cheese
4 hard-cooked eggs, peeled, sliced
4 teaspoons real bacon pieces

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400°F. Spread honey mustard evenly on English muffin halves; place on ungreased cookie sheet. Top each with cheese, egg and bacon.
  • Bake at 400°F. for 3 to 4 minutes or until cheese melts and sandwiches are heated through.

BACON-AND-EGG MUFFINS



Bacon-and-Egg Muffins image

Great brunch item and has many ways to customize this with egg styles and flavors to add.

Provided by cbauer10

Categories     100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es     Eggs     Breakfast Sandwich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 10

cooking spray
12 slices bacon
10 eggs
¼ cup milk
¼ cup chopped green onion
¼ cup diced jalapeno pepper
¼ cup diced roasted red pepper
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on ground black pepper
½ cup shredded C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Prepare 12 muffin cups with cooking spray.
  • Arrange bacon on a microwave-safe plate. Cook bacon in microwave for 75 seconds.
  • Place a slice of bacon into each muffin cup so that the bacon lines the edges of the cup.
  • Beat eggs and milk together in a bowl; ladle into muffin cups. Top 4 of the egg portions with 1 tablespoon each of the green onion, 4 with 1 tablespoon each jalapeno pepper, and 4 each with 1 tablespoon roasted red pepper.
  • Bake in preheated oven until only slightly moist on top, about 20 minutes. Season the muffins with salt and pepper; top with Cheddar cheese. Continue baking until the cheese melts, about 5 minutes more.

BACON-EGG ENGLISH MUFFIN



Bacon-Egg English Muffin image

Terry Kuehn of Waunakee, Wisconsin stacks cheese, Canadian bacon and poached eggs on an English muffin to make this appealing eye-opener. Perfect for one, this delicious open-faced sandwich is special enough for guests, too.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Breakfast     Brunch

Time 15m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 tablespoon white vinegar
2 large eggs
1 tablespoon cream cheese, softened
1 English muffin, split and toasted
2 slices process American cheese
2 slices Canadian bacon

Steps:

  • Place 2-3 in. of water in a large skillet with high sides; add vinegar. Bring to a boil; reduce heat and simmer gently. Break cold eggs, one at a time, into a custard cup or saucer; holding the cup close to the surface of the water, slip egg into water. Cook, uncovered, until whites are completely set, about 4 minutes. , Meanwhile, spread cream cheese over muffin halves. Top with cheese slices and Canadian bacon. Using a slotted spoon, lift eggs out of water and place over bacon.

EGG-STUFFED BACON AND CHEESE MUFFINS



Egg-Stuffed Bacon and Cheese Muffins image

Enjoy a full breakfast in one loaded muffin: soft-boiled eggs included! Inspired by the beloved muffins from San Francisco bakery Craftsman and Wolves that have taken patrons and TikTok enthusiasts by storm, we gave these muffins a unique spin with crispy bacon and salty Irish Cheddar studded in each bite. Make sure not to overbake--doing so could turn the beautifully jammy eggs to hard-boiled in a matter of minutes. Serve these warm on their own, or with a sprinkle of flaky sea salt and hot sauce for a transportable, savory, breakfast.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h20m

Yield 6 muffins

Number Of Ingredients 16

6 slices bacon
10 large eggs
Nonstick cooking spray, for the muffin tin
1 2/3
cups all-purpose flour, plus more for dusting the eggs (see Cook's Note)
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
3/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
Pinch of granulated sugar
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1/2 cup nonfat plain Greek yogurt
4 ounces Irish Cheddar, shredded on the large holes of a box grater (about 1 cup)
1/4 cup grated Pecorino Romano (about 1 1/2 ounces)
4 scallions, thinly sliced (about 1/4 cup)
Flaky sea salt and hot sauce, for serving

Steps:

  • Put the bacon in a large skillet and place over medium heat. Cook, flipping occasionally, until golden brown and crispy, about 8 minutes. Drain on a paper towel-lined plate, then finely chop.
  • Meanwhile, fill a large bowl with lots of ice and water; set aside. Bring a large saucepan of water to a boil over medium-high heat. Gently lower 6 of the eggs into the water with a slotted spoon and cook until soft boiled (the whites have set but the yolks are still runny), 5 minutes (see Cook's Note). Transfer the eggs immediately to the ice water bath to stop the cooking and let sit until completely cool, about 15 minutes. Carefully peel the eggs and reserve.
  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F and spray a 6-cup jumbo muffin tin generously with nonstick cooking spray.
  • Whisk the flour, baking powder, kosher salt, baking soda, pepper and sugar in a medium bowl until evenly combined. Whisk the vegetable oil, yogurt and remaining 4 eggs in a large bowl until smooth and combined. Stir the flour mixture into the yogurt mixture until just combined (do not overmix), then gently fold in the Cheddar, Pecorino Romano, scallions and reserved bacon until just combined. Transfer to a piping bag or resealable freezer bag and snip the tip. Put a couple tablespoons of flour in a small bowl.
  • Pipe enough batter into each prepared muffin cup to just cover the bottom and help anchor the soft-boiled eggs. Carefully dust the soft-boiled eggs in the flour, shaking off any excess (this will help the batter to adhere), then place 1 upright in each muffin cup. Pipe the remaining batter around and on top of the eggs, making sure the eggs are completely coated. Use a rubber spatula or offset spatula to help smooth out the tops of each muffin (they should look domed).
  • Bake until the muffin tops are light golden brown, the batter is just cooked through and the eggs inside are soft and jammy, about 16 minutes. Let the muffins sit in the tin for just 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ack. Enjoy warm cut in half with a sprinkle of flaky sea salt and a few dashes of hot sauce. Alternatively, let the muffins come to room temperature, then refrigerate in an airtight container for up to 5 days.

BACON AND EGG BREAKFAST MUFFINS



Bacon and Egg Breakfast Muffins image

Make and share this Bacon and Egg Breakfast Muffins rec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Pinay0618

Categories     Quick Breads

Time 56m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 cups white lily self-rising flour
2 tablespoons granulated sugar
1 teaspoon dry mustard
3/4 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
1 large egg, lightly beaten
3/4 cup milk
1/4 cup crisco vegetable oil
2 large eggs, hard boiled and diced
4 slices cooked bacon, drained and crumbled

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400 degrees. Lightly spray 12 muffin cups with no-stick cooking spray or use muffin cup liners.
  • Combine flour, sugar, and dry mustard.
  • Stir in cheese and make a well in the center of the ingredients.
  • Whisk together egg, milk and oil. Add all at once to the flour mixture, stirring just until moistened.
  • Fill prepared muffin cups 1/3 full (half the batter will be used).
  • Combine the diced egg and cooked crumbled bacon. Divide evenly into muffin cups.
  • Top with remaining batter. Muffin cups should be about 2/3 full.
  • Bake for 20 to 25 minutes or until muffins are lightly browned.
  • Serve hot.

EGG AND BACON BREAD BOWL MUFFINS



Egg and Bacon Bread Bowl Muffins image

Bread bowls made in a large muffin tin with cheese, egg, and bacon cooked right inside.

Provided by Beth

Categories     100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es     Eggs

Time 2h30m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 16

¼ cup warm water (110 degrees F/45 degrees C)
3 tablespoons white sugar
1 (.25 ounce) package quick-rise active dry yeast
cooking spray
2 ¾ cups all-purpose flour, or more as needed
1 te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
½ teaspoon ground cardamom
½ teaspoon ground ginger
¼ teaspoon sweet paprika
½ cup almond milk, at room temperature, or more as needed
3 tablespoons salted butter, melted and cooled to room temperature
1 large egg, at room temperature
6 slices bacon
¼ cup shredded Cheddar cheese
6 large eggs

Steps:

  • Mix warm water, sugar, and yeast together in a bowl. Proof yeast until it softens and begins to form a creamy foam, 5 to 10 minutes.
  • Spray a large bowl with cooking spray.
  • Stir together 2 3/4 cups flour, salt, pepper, cardamom, ginger, and paprika in the bowl of a stand mixer until well combined. Make a well in the center and pour in the yeast mixture, 1/2 cup almond milk, butter, and egg. Stir with the dough hook attachment on low speed until the dough comes together. If dough sticks to the side of the bowl, add flour, 1 tablespoon at a time, until smooth. If dough is too dry and does not come together, add 1 teaspoon almond milk at a time.
  • Knead dough with the dough hook attachment until smooth and supple, about 6 minutes. Transfer dough to the oiled bowl. Spray additional cooking spray on top of the dough. Cover the bowl with a clean, damp kitchen towel or plastic wrap. Allow dough to rise until doubled in size, about 1 hour.
  • Roll dough on a lightly floured surface to a 1/4-inch thickness. Cut circles with a 4-inch round biscuit or cookie cutter.
  • Lightly oil a large 6-cup muffin tin with cooking spray. Place about 3 dough circles in each cup, overlapping to cover the sides and bottom; press to seal. Set aside to rise for 30 to 45 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, place bacon in a large skillet and cook over medium-high heat, turning occasionally, until mostly cooked but slightly underdone, 7 to 10 minutes. Drain bacon slices on paper towels and break each slice into 4-inch pieces.
  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  • Sprinkle a small amount of Cheddar cheese into each muffin cup. Place 2 to 3 pieces bacon on top of each, leaving the underdone ends sticking out to cook as the muffins bake. Crack an egg into each muffin and sprinkle additional Cheddar on top.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until eggs are set but yolks are slightly runny, about 18 minutes.

EGG AND BACON MUFFIN CUPS



Egg and Bacon Muffin Cups image

Provided by Catherine McCord

Categories     Egg     Pork     Breakfast     Brunch     Kid-Friendly     Quick & Easy     Weelicious     Sugar Conscious     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Small Plates

Yield Serves 6

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 sheet frozen puff pastry (17.3 ounce box), thawed and chilled
13 large eggs
2 strips thick-cut bacon, roughly chopped
4 tablespoons grated parmesan cheese
Salt
1 tablespoon water

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Unfold the puff pastry sheet and cut sheet in 6 equal pieces. Gently stretch each piece into a 5x5 inch square.
  • Place each piece of pastry in a greased muffin cup leaving a 1/2 overhang at the top.
  • Sprinkle one teaspoon of the parmesan in the pastry lined cups, crack an egg into each cup, top with bacon, 1 teaspoon parmesan cheese, and a pinch of salt.
  • Whisk together the remaining egg and water and lightly brush pastry edges with egg wash.
  • Bake for 20 minutes, remove from oven and immediately move to a wire rack. Let cool 5 minutes and then serve.
